编解码开发是软件工程中的重要环节,涉及数据的转换与处理。从交互视角来看,开发者不仅要关注技术实现,还需考虑用户与系统的互动体验。
在设计编解码逻辑时,清晰的输入输出定义是基础。明确数据格式和协议,有助于减少误解和错误,提升系统稳定性。
代码结构的合理规划能显著提高可维护性。使用模块化设计,将编码与解码逻辑分离,便于后期扩展和调试。

本图由AI生成,仅供参考
注释与文档同样重要。良好的注释能够帮助他人快速理解代码意图,而完整的文档则为后续开发提供参考依据。
测试是确保编解码功能可靠的关键步骤。通过覆盖不同场景的测试用例,可以发现潜在问题并优化性能。
在实际应用中,性能优化不容忽视。例如,采用高效的算法或缓存机制,可以提升数据处理速度。
•保持对新技术的学习与探索,有助于在编解码领域不断进步,适应日益复杂的业务需求。